简介:本文将介绍PyTorch在图像分类、图像增强和图像分割方面的应用,涵盖基本概念、技术细节和实际应用。通过学习这些技术,读者将能够更好地理解和使用PyTorch进行图像处理任务。
图像分类是计算机视觉领域的一项基本任务,其目标是将输入的图像自动标记为预定义的类别。在PyTorch中,可以使用卷积神经网络(Convolutional Neural Networks,CNN)进行图像分类。CNN是一种深度学习模型,专门用于处理图像数据。在PyTorch中,可以使用预训练的CNN模型进行图像分类,也可以自己构建模型。对于图像增强的目的在于改进图像的质量,以便更好地进行后续的图像处理任务。在PyTorch中,可以使用各种数据增强技术来对图像进行旋转、翻转、裁剪等操作,以便增加模型的泛化能力。图像分割是计算机视觉领域的一项重要任务,其目标是将图像分割成多个区域,每个区域表示一个对象或物体。在PyTorch中,可以使用各种分割算法进行图像分割,如FCN、U-Net等。通过学习这些技术,读者将能够更好地理解和使用PyTorch进行图像处理任务。在实际应用中,可以根据具体任务选择合适的算法和技术,并进行相应的优化和调整。同时,还需要注意数据的质量和标注的准确性,以便获得更好的模型性能。